Output d05393ab201f1039078c6632dde2c355df37815999cc78aa57b29cddd57be786:0

value
2676956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 09c830452761002765265a6ce673b572cfde6dcc OP_EQUALVERIFY OP_CHECKSIG
address
1tiu58Jb6YVAyBxF4AxJ7Q7U73N5g4eCs
transaction
d05393ab201f1039078c6632dde2c355df37815999cc78aa57b29cddd57be786
spent
true